You were too jealous to let it happen, weren't you?

The speaker is blaming the other person for stopping something because of jealousy.

From Billionaire Daughter’S Love Triangle, Episode 39

When do people say this?

Scene Context

The speaker accuses someone of being too jealous to allow something to happen.

Usage Scenario

Use this in a heated argument when accusing someone of jealousy. It is confrontational and not polite.

Better ways to say it

1
You were too jealous to let it happen, weren't you?
2
You were just jealous.
3
You didn't want it to happen because you were jealous.
